Pronotum mostly elongate to trapezoidal, globose in Notoxini, larger than head, widest in anterior third, narrowing in basal half (except Ischaliinae); lateral margins not bordered (except Ischaliinae). Prosternum narrow in front of contiguous procoxae; procoxae conical, prominent; procoxal cavities open posteriorly (closed in Ictystignini), closed internally by internal apodeme extending from lateral foveae above procoxae (foveae lacking in Lagrioidinae, Ischaliinae, and Steropinae). Thin, well defined sulcus in many originating at lateral foveae and extending posterodorsally to cross dorsum just anterior to base. Pronotal apex simple, dorsally flanged, or with distinct collar; prominent apicodorsal horn projecting over head in Notoxini.
